
如何在Excel中直接转换成PPT
直接在Excel中转换成PPT的主要方法有:使用Excel中的导出功能、手动复制粘贴、使用第三方插件、VBA宏编程。其中使用Excel中的导出功能是最简单和直接的方法,能够高效地将数据和图表从Excel转移到PPT中。下面将详细介绍这些方法,并提供具体的操作步骤和注意事项。
一、使用Excel中的导出功能
Excel本身提供了一些内置功能,可以帮助用户将工作表中的内容直接导出到PPT中。这种方法尤其适用于一些简单的转换需求。
1.1 导出为PDF再转为PPT
- 打开需要转换的Excel文件。
- 点击“文件”菜单,选择“另存为”。
- 在文件类型中选择“PDF”。
- 保存PDF文件后,打开PowerPoint。
- 在PowerPoint中导入PDF文件(通过插入对象或其他方式),然后进行必要的编辑和调整。
1.2 使用PowerPoint模板
- 打开Excel文件。
- 选择要转换的内容(如表格、图表等)。
- 右键点击选中的内容,选择“复制”。
- 打开PowerPoint文件,选择相应的幻灯片。
- 右键点击幻灯片,选择“粘贴”,并选择适当的粘贴选项(如“保留源格式”或“使用目标主题”)。
二、手动复制粘贴
手动复制粘贴是最简单直接的方法,适用于小规模的转换需求。通过这种方法,可以确保每个元素都能精确地复制到PPT中。
2.1 复制表格
- 在Excel中选择要复制的表格区域。
- 右键点击选择区域,选择“复制”。
- 打开PowerPoint文件,选择要插入表格的幻灯片。
- 右键点击幻灯片,选择“粘贴”。
- 根据需要调整表格大小和位置。
2.2 复制图表
- 在Excel中选择要复制的图表。
- 右键点击图表,选择“复制”。
- 打开PowerPoint文件,选择要插入图表的幻灯片。
- 右键点击幻灯片,选择“粘贴”。
- 根据需要调整图表大小和位置。
三、使用第三方插件
一些第三方插件可以帮助用户更高效地将Excel内容转换为PPT。这些插件通常提供更多的自定义选项和自动化功能。
3.1 插件推荐
- Think-Cell:这是一款广泛使用的商业插件,专注于图表和幻灯片的创建和管理。它可以自动将Excel中的数据转换为PPT中的图表,并保持数据同步。
- Power-user:这是一款综合性的办公插件,提供了大量的PPT和Excel模板、图表工具和其他功能,帮助用户更高效地进行转换和编辑。
3.2 使用方法
- 下载并安装所需的插件。
- 打开Excel文件,选择要转换的内容。
- 根据插件的使用说明,将内容转换为PPT(通常涉及点击插件工具栏中的相应按钮)。
- 打开PowerPoint文件,查看转换结果,并进行必要的调整。
四、VBA宏编程
对于有编程基础的用户,可以使用VBA(Visual Basic for Applications)宏编程来实现Excel到PPT的自动化转换。这种方法适用于需要频繁进行大规模转换的场景。
4.1 VBA宏基础
VBA宏是一种脚本语言,嵌入在Office应用程序中,允许用户编写代码来自动化各种任务。
4.2 创建VBA宏
- 打开Excel文件,按下“Alt + F11”打开VBA编辑器。
- 在VBA编辑器中,插入一个新模块(通过点击“插入”菜单,然后选择“模块”)。
- 在模块中编写以下代码:
Sub ExportExcelToPPT()
Dim pptApp As Object
Dim pptPres As Object
Dim pptSlide As Object
Dim ws As Worksheet
Dim rng As Range
' 创建PowerPoint应用程序对象
Set pptApp = CreateObject("PowerPoint.Application")
pptApp.Visible = True
' 创建一个新的演示文稿
Set pptPres = pptApp.Presentations.Add
' 获取当前工作表和选择区域
Set ws = ThisWorkbook.Sheets(1)
Set rng = ws.Range("A1:D10") ' 需要调整为实际需要的范围
' 复制Excel区域并粘贴到PPT中
rng.Copy
Set pptSlide = pptPres.Slides.Add(1, 1) ' 添加一个新幻灯片
pptSlide.Shapes.PasteSpecial DataType:=2 ' 2代表图片格式
' 清理
Set pptSlide = Nothing
Set pptPres = Nothing
Set pptApp = Nothing
End Sub
- 关闭VBA编辑器,返回Excel。
- 按下“Alt + F8”打开宏对话框,选择刚才创建的宏,然后点击“运行”。
五、注意事项和最佳实践
在进行Excel到PPT的转换时,有一些注意事项和最佳实践可以帮助提高效率和效果。
5.1 保持格式一致性
确保在Excel中使用的字体、颜色和样式与PPT中的主题一致。这有助于保持演示文稿的专业外观和一致性。
5.2 数据更新和同步
如果Excel中的数据需要频繁更新,可以考虑使用链接或动态数据更新功能,以确保PPT中的数据始终是最新的。
5.3 图表和表格的选择
选择适当的图表和表格类型,以便在PPT中清晰地展示数据。避免使用过于复杂或难以理解的图表。
5.4 使用模板
使用预先设计的PPT模板,可以节省时间并确保演示文稿的视觉效果。许多在线资源提供免费的PPT模板,适用于各种场合。
六、总结
将Excel内容直接转换为PPT是一个常见且实用的需求。通过使用Excel中的导出功能、手动复制粘贴、第三方插件和VBA宏编程,可以高效地实现这一目标。选择合适的方法取决于具体的需求和用户的熟练程度。无论选择哪种方法,保持格式一致性、数据同步和合理的图表选择都是确保转换效果的关键。
相关问答FAQs:
1. 如何将Excel表格直接转换为PPT幻灯片?
- Q:我可以直接将Excel表格转换为PPT幻灯片吗?
- A:是的,你可以通过一些方法将Excel表格直接转换为PPT幻灯片,方便展示和分享数据。
2. 我该如何将Excel中的数据转换为PPT图表?
- Q:如何将Excel中的数据转换为漂亮的PPT图表?
- A:你可以使用Excel中的"插入"选项,选择合适的图表类型,并将Excel中的数据导入到图表中。然后,你可以将图表复制到PPT中,以便在幻灯片中展示。
3. 有没有快捷的方法可以将Excel中的表格复制到PPT幻灯片中?
- Q:我想直接将Excel中的表格复制到PPT幻灯片中,有没有更快捷的方法?
- A:可以使用快捷键将Excel表格复制到PPT幻灯片中。在Excel中选择表格,按下Ctrl+C复制,然后在PPT中按下Ctrl+V粘贴,即可将表格快速复制到幻灯片中。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4238407